李成笔记网

专注域名、站长SEO知识分享与实战技巧

IPv6vsIPv4使用差异说明 ipv6ipv4区别

在当今互联网快速发展的背景下,IPv4(Internet Protocol version 4)和IPv6(Internet Protocol version 6)作为两种核心的互联网协议,承担着标识和定位网络设备的关键任务。随着互联网设备数量的激增,IPv4面临地址枯竭的问题,IPv6应运而生,旨在解决这一问题并引入更多功能。本文将详细分析IPv4和IPv6在多个方面的使用差异,帮助您全面理解这两种协议的特点与应用。

目录

  1. 地址长度
  2. 地址表示
  3. 自动配置
  4. 网络层协议
  5. IP包大小
  6. 支持的功能
  7. 兼容性
  8. 总结
  9. 操作流程图
  10. 注意事项

地址长度

IPv4

  • 长度:32位。
  • 地址数量:总共可提供约40亿个唯一的IP地址。
  • 解析
    IPv4地址由四个8位的二进制数(称为八位字节)组成,每个八位字节通过点分十进制表示,例如 192.168.0.1。32位地址空间允许约 2^32个地址,即约42.95亿个地址。然而,实际可用地址数量由于保留地址和私有地址的使用有所减少。

IPv6

  • 长度:128位。
  • 地址数量:总共可提供约3.4 × 10^38个唯一的IP地址。
  • 解析
    IPv6地址由八组四位十六进制数通过冒号分隔组成,例如 2001:0db8:85a3:0000:0000:8a2e:0370:7334。128位的地址长度大幅增加了可用地址空间,解决了IPv4地址枯竭的问题,并为未来的互联网发展提供了充足的地址资源。

地址表示

IPv4

  • 表示法:点分十进制表示法。
  • 格式:A.B.C.D,其中A、B、C、D为0-255之间的整数。
  • 示例:192.168.0.1
  • 解析
    每个八位字节通过点分隔,易于记忆和识别,但在面对大规模网络时,地址数量显得捉襟见肘。

IPv6

  • 表示法:冒号分隔的十六进制表示法。
  • 格式:X:X:X:X:X:X:X:X,其中每个 X代表四位十六进制数(0000-FFFF)。
  • 示例:2001:0db8:85a3:0000:0000:8a2e:0370:7334
  • 简化表示
    连续的零可以通过双冒号 ::进行简化,但只能出现一次。
  • 示例:2001:db8:85a3::8a2e:370:7334
  • 解析
    虽然IPv6地址长度更长,使用十六进制表示法有助于减少字符数,并通过双冒号简化书写,但仍需一定的学习和适应。

自动配置

IPv4

  • 配置方式:通常通过DHCP(动态主机配置协议)进行地址分配和配置。
  • 解析
    在IPv4网络中,DHCP服务器负责为客户端设备分配IP地址、子网掩码、默认网关和DNS服务器等配置信息。这种方式简化了网络管理,但需要额外的DHCP服务器支持。

IPv6

  • 配置方式:支持无状态自动地址配置(SLAAC)和DHCPv6
  • 解析
    IPv6设备可以基于路由器发送的广播消息自动生成IP地址,减少了对集中式DHCP服务器的依赖。同时,DHCPv6仍可用于提供额外的配置信息,如DNS服务器地址。这种灵活性提高了网络配置的效率和可扩展性。

网络层协议

IPv4

  • 主要传输协议TCP(传输控制协议)和UDP(用户数据报协议)。
  • 解析
    TCP提供可靠的、面向连接的传输服务,适用于需要高可靠性的应用,如网页浏览和文件传输。UDP提供无连接的、不保证可靠性的传输服务,适用于实时应用,如视频会议和在线游戏。

IPv6

  • 主要传输协议:除TCPUDP外,还引入了SCTP(流控制传输协议)。
  • 解析
    SCTP提供了类似于TCP的可靠传输,同时支持多流和多宿主功能,适用于需要高可靠性和多路径传输的应用,如电信信令和高性能计算。

IP包大小

IPv4

  • 最大数据报大小:64KB。
  • 常见的MTU(最大传输单元):1500字节。
  • 解析
    IPv4的数据报大小受到网络设备的限制,常见的MTU值为1500字节,确保数据包在网络中高效传输,减少分片的需求。

IPv6

  • 最大数据报大小:4GB。
  • 常见的MTU:1280字节。
  • 解析
    IPv6将最大数据报大小扩展至4GB,尽管实际网络中常用的MTU值为1280字节,保证了数据包在所有IPv6网络中能够传输而无需分片,提高了网络效率和性能。

支持的功能

IPv4

  • 功能:基本的IP地址分配、路由和数据传输。
  • 解析
    IPv4协议提供了基础的网络层功能,支持点对点和点对多点的数据传输,但在安全性和扩展性方面存在局限。

IPv6

  • 新增功能
    • IPsec:内置的安全协议,提供端到端的加密和认证,增强了网络通信的安全性。
    • 多播的本地链路地址:改进了多播功能,支持更高效的组通信。
    • 无状态地址自动配置(SLAAC):支持设备自动生成IP地址,简化网络配置。
    • 扩展头:通过扩展头机制,提高了协议的灵活性和扩展性。
  • 解析
    IPv6在设计时考虑了现代互联网的需求,内置了多项高级功能,提升了网络的安全性、效率和可管理性,满足了大规模网络环境的需求。

兼容性

IPv4

  • 现状广泛采用,是目前互联网上最主流的IP协议。
  • 问题:IPv4地址枯竭,无法满足不断增长的互联网设备需求。
  • 解析
    虽然IPv4在全球范围内得到广泛支持,但由于地址数量有限,导致许多设备和服务需要通过网络地址转换(NAT)等技术共享IP地址,增加了网络复杂性和延迟。

IPv6

  • 现状:作为IPv4的升级,逐步在全球范围内推广。
  • 优势:解决了IPv4地址短缺问题,提供更多的功能和更高的安全性。
  • 解析
    IPv6的引入旨在取代IPv4,逐步实现全新的互联网地址体系。然而,过渡期间,IPv4和IPv6需要并行运行,确保兼容性和互操作性,这对网络设备和管理提出了更高的要求。

分析说明表

以下表格总结了IPv4和IPv6在关键方面的差异,便于直观理解两者的不同点。

特性

IPv4

IPv6

地址长度

32位

128位

地址数量

约40亿个

约3.4 × 10^38个

地址表示

点分十进制(如192.168.0.1)

冒号分隔的十六进制(如2001:0db8::8a2e:0370:7334)

自动配置

依赖DHCP

支持SLAAC和DHCPv6

网络层协议

TCP、UDP

TCP、UDP、SCTP

IP包大小

最大64KB,常见MTU 1500字节

最大4GB,常见MTU 1280字节

支持的功能

基本的IP地址分配和路由

内置IPsec、多播改进、SLAAC、扩展头等

兼容性

广泛采用,地址枯竭问题

逐步推广,与IPv4兼容但需并行运行

安全性

需要额外配置IPsec等安全协议

内置IPsec,提供更高的安全性

地址分配

需要手动或DHCP分配

设备可自动生成地址,减少配置复杂性

路由效率

随着地址数量增加,路由表变得庞大且复杂

地址层次结构优化,路由效率更高

移动性支持

移动设备支持有限,需依赖额外协议

原生支持移动性,适应移动设备的需求

扩展性

难以扩展,需通过NAT等技术实现大规模网络扩展

设计之初即考虑扩展性,支持大规模网络和新功能的集成


注意事项

在部署和使用IPv4与IPv6时,需注意以下关键事项,以确保网络的稳定性和安全性:

  • 备份数据:在进行任何网络配置更改之前,务必备份重要数据,防止配置错误导致的数据丢失或网络中断。
  • 管理员权限:确保拥有足够的管理员权限(通常为 root或 sudo权限),以执行必要的配置和安装命令。
  • 网络配置:在企业网络或防火墙后部署时,确保相关端口(如IPv4的80、443端口,IPv6的相应端口)已开放,并正确配置DNS解析,确保设备能够顺利通信。
  • 安全配置强烈建议在生产环境中启用TLS/SSL,并使用IPsec等安全协议,确保数据传输的安全性。设置适当的访问控制,防止未授权访问。
  • 资源需求确保服务器具备足够的资源(CPU、内存、存储)以支持IPv6的运行,尤其是在处理大量网络设备和高流量时。
  • 日志监控定期监控网络日志,及时发现和解决潜在问题,确保网络的稳定性和可靠性。
  • 版本兼容性:确保网络设备、操作系统和应用程序支持IPv6,避免因版本不兼容导致的功能障碍。
  • 过渡策略:在从IPv4过渡到IPv6的过程中,制定清晰的过渡策略,确保IPv4和IPv6能够并行运行,保障网络的连续性和稳定性。
  • 培训与支持:为网络管理员和相关技术人员提供必要的培训和支持,确保他们熟悉IPv6的配置和管理,提高网络运维效率。

总结

IPv4IPv6作为互联网的核心协议,在地址长度、表示方式、自动配置、支持功能和兼容性等方面存在显著差异。IPv6通过扩大地址空间、引入新功能和提升网络效率,解决了IPv4面临的地址枯竭问题,并为未来的互联网发展提供了坚实的基础。然而,IPv4仍在全球范围内广泛应用,过渡到IPv6需要时间和策略。

在实际应用中,IPv6的部署需要考虑到网络设备的兼容性、配置的复杂性以及安全性的提升。通过合理规划和逐步实施,企业和组织可以有效利用IPv6的优势,提升网络的扩展性和安全性。

重要提示虽然IPv6具备许多优势,但在当前阶段,IPv4仍然占据主导地位。因此,在网络部署和配置时,应同时支持IPv4和IPv6,确保网络的兼容性和灵活性,满足不同设备和应用的需求。

注意事项

在实际部署和使用IPv4IPv6时,需要注意以下事项,以确保网络的稳定性、安全性和高效性:

  1. 备份数据
  2. 在进行任何网络配置更改之前,务必备份重要数据,以防止配置错误导致的数据丢失或网络中断。
  3. 管理员权限
  4. 确保拥有足够的管理员权限(通常为 root或 sudo权限),以执行必要的配置和安装命令。
  5. 网络配置
  6. 在企业网络或防火墙后部署时,确保相关端口已开放,并正确配置DNS解析,确保设备能够顺利通信。
  7. 安全配置
  8. 强烈建议在生产环境中启用TLS/SSL,并使用IPsec等安全协议,确保数据传输的安全性。设置适当的访问控制,防止未授权访问。
  9. 资源需求
  10. 确保服务器具备足够的资源(CPU、内存、存储)以支持IPv6的运行,尤其是在处理大量网络设备和高流量时。
  11. 日志监控
  12. 定期监控网络日志,及时发现和解决潜在问题,确保网络的稳定性和可靠性。
  13. 版本兼容性
  14. 确保网络设备、操作系统和应用程序支持IPv6,避免因版本不兼容导致的功能障碍。
  15. 过渡策略
  16. 在从IPv4过渡到IPv6的过程中,制定清晰的过渡策略,确保IPv4和IPv6能够并行运行,保障网络的连续性和稳定性。
  17. 培训与支持
  18. 为网络管理员和相关技术人员提供必要的培训和支持,确保他们熟悉IPv6的配置和管理,提高网络运维效率。
  19. 性能优化
  20. 根据实际需求,调整IPv6的配置参数,优化网络性能,确保高效的数据传输和处理。

总结

IPv4IPv6作为两种核心的互联网协议,在地址长度、表示方式、自动配置、支持功能和兼容性等方面存在显著差异。IPv6通过扩大地址空间、引入新功能和提升网络效率,解决了IPv4面临的地址枯竭问题,并为未来的互联网发展提供了坚实的基础。然而,IPv4仍在全球范围内广泛应用,过渡到IPv6需要时间和策略。

在实际应用中,IPv6的部署需要考虑到网络设备的兼容性、配置的复杂性以及安全性的提升。通过合理规划和逐步实施,企业和组织可以有效利用IPv6的优势,提升网络的扩展性和安全性。

重要提示虽然IPv6具备许多优势,但在当前阶段,IPv4仍然占据主导地位。因此,在网络部署和配置时,应同时支持IPv4和IPv6,确保网络的兼容性和灵活性,满足不同设备和应用的需求。

通过深入理解IPv4和IPv6的差异,网络管理员和技术人员能够更好地规划和管理网络,确保互联网基础设施的稳定性、安全性和高效性,为用户提供更优质的网络服务。

发表评论:

控制面板
您好,欢迎到访网站!
  查看权限
网站分类
最新留言